WebGraphite, with a hexagonal-layer structure, is the equi-librium crystallographic form of carbon. The small crystallites of disordered graphitizing carbons have a similar structure, except that there is no long-range order in the stacking sequence of the basal-layer planes (turbo-stratic structure). Materials may be classified by their response to externally applied magnetic fields as diamagnetic, paramagnetic, or ferromagnetic. These magnetic responses differ greatly in strength. Diamagnetism is a property of all materials and opposes applied magnetic fields, but is very weak.
